(1) There is hereby established in the State Treasury a separate trust and agency account to be known as the "Agriculture Promotion Fund" to be administered by the Department of Agriculture for the purposes provided in this section. Any moneys accruing to this fund in any fiscal year shall not lapse but shall be carried forward to the next fiscal year. (2) (a) Any moneys deposited in the fund shall be used to purchase materials to promote agriculture in the Commonwealth; (b) Any moneys received from the sale of promotional materials shall be deposited in the fund; and (c) The fund may receive state appropriations, gifts, grants, and federal funds.
